What is concrete finishing?

Concrete finishing is the process used to level, treat, and texture the surface of freshly poured concrete. It ensures the surface is structurally sound, smooth where it needs to be, and prepared for its intended use. Why is concrete finishing important?

Industrial floors endure constant pressure. Forklifts, machinery, foot traffic, and changes in temperature can all take their toll. Concrete finishing improves the load-bearing capacity of your floor, reduces slip risks, and increases long-term resistance to wear and abrasion. Without proper finishing, even a high-quality slab can suffer from premature damage like cracking, dusting, or surface delamination.

Common concrete finishing techniques

We offer a range of finishing options to suit different industrial and commercial settings. Here's a breakdown of the most common techniques we use:

Screeding
The process begins with screeding – levelling the poured concrete using a screed tool or laser screed. This ensures a flat base for any further surface treatments.

Dust Topping (for power-floated floors)
Used for smooth and polished floors, this involves applying a pre-mixed powder to the surface before power-floating. It enhances abrasion resistance and can include colour finishes. Ideal for factories, warehouses and other indoor industrial spaces.

Brush Finish
This finish is created by dragging a wire concrete brush across freshly levelled concrete. It creates a coarse, non-slip surface and supports drainage, making it well-suited to car parks and external loading areas.

Tamped Finish
Formed by tamping the surface with a beam to produce a ridged pattern. This improves grip and water runoff and is commonly used in agricultural and outdoor environments.

Power Trowel / Power Float
Machines like ride-on power floats are used to deliver a highly polished, smooth surface. This is a popular option for industrial sites needing a clean, durable and attractive finish.

Concrete sealing

As a final step, industrial floors should be sealed to protect against dust, moisture, oil and surface wear. This enhances longevity and reduces the need for early maintenance or resurfacing.
